Income Statement | Dec 24 | Dec 23 | Dec 22 | Dec 21 | Dec 20 |
---|---|---|---|---|---|
$ 328.06M | $ 287.38M | $ 267.37M | $ 245.24M | $ 220.78M | |
$ 199.95M | $ 181.28M | $ 159.82M | $ 142.94M | $ 132.57M | |
$ 228.54M | $ 171.65M | $ 161.29M | $ 137.66M | $ 133.72M | |
$ 98.45M | $ 66.09M | $ 69.43M | $ 55.63M | $ 49.04M | |
$ 76.32M | $ 78.27M | $ 67.43M | $ 60.91M | $ 46.44M | |
$ -28.59M | $ 9.62M | $ 5.03M | $ 13.00M | $ -1.15M | |
$ -9.44M | $ 1.39M | $ -1.35M | $ 8.66M | $ 3.19M | |
$ -38.03M | $ 11.01M | $ -9.31M | $ 6.24M | $ 2.04M | |
$ 190.39M | $ 8.04M | $ -8.38M | $ 7.93M | $ 2.63M | |
$ ― | $ ― | $ ― | $ ― | $ ― | |
$ 3.54 | $ 0.16 | $ -0.17 | $ 0.16 | $ 0.05 | |
$ 3.54 | $ 0.16 | $ -0.17 | $ 0.16 | $ 0.05 | |
53.72M | 50.40M | 50.16M | 50.03M | 49.90M | |
53.72M | 50.72M | 50.16M | 50.15M | 50.02M |